Find the volume of a cylinder with a radius of 12 and a height of 5. Use 3.14 for

Answer:

the volume of a cylinder = 2260.8m³

Step-by-step explanation:

inorder to find the volume of a cylinder

given that

radius = 12

height = 5

π = 3.14

recall that the formlae for finding the volume of a cylinder = πr²h

the volume of a cylinder = πr²h

the volume of a cylinder = 3.14 x (12) ²x  5

the volume of a cylinder = 3.14 x 144 x 5

the volume of a cylinder = 3.14 x 720

the volume of a cylinder = 2260.8m³
